The Minister of Local Government and Rural Development, Mr. Samuel Ofosu Ampofo has given a personal donation of GH¢100 to each of five visually impaired students of the Okuapeman SHS at the 54th speech and prize giving day at Akropong Akuapem on Saturday, for coming tops in their various classes
They were given various prizes and the Minister was so touched with their performances that he had no option than to assist them also.
The recipients are Carruthers Tetteh, Juliana Mohammed, Ebenezer Azumah, Victor Aklema and Sandra Birikorang.
Mr Ofosu Ampofo said what moved him was Ebenezer Azumah emerging the overall best third year student in literature over and above colleague students without any eyes defects.
“I am much amazed to see the visually impaired completing fairly with students with sight and coming out the best,” he intimatedd.
In all, there are 68 visually impaired students in Okuapeman SHS.
